SM12 FYZ is a 2012 Fiat Punto in Black with a 1,368cc petrol engine. This vehicle has been through 14 MOT tests with a personal pass rate of 64.3%.
Across all 2012 Fiat Punto models, the average MOT pass rate is 72.5% with a typical mileage of 51,720 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Fiat Punto f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 377,326 recorded failures. If you're considering buying SM12 FYZ, it's worth having these areas checked by a mechanic before committing.
The Fiat Punto typically stays on UK roads for around 32 years. At 14 years old, this Fiat Punto is still in the earlier part of its expected life.
